Samsung has sold 1 million Galaxy Fold phones

Samsung may have sold up to a million Galaxy Fold smartphones worldwide since kicking off sales in the US in late September.

Axar.az reports citing Zdnet that Samsung Electronic's president Young Sohn made the claim about Galaxy Fold sales at the TechCrunch Disrupt conference in Berlin yesterday.

"And I think that the point is, we're selling [a] million of these products. There are a million people that want to use this product at $2,000," Sohn said.

Sohn said Samsung was fine with selling a $2,000 device that is a beta product and that the sales number justified its decision.
